Vietnam PM Approves Central Highlands Development Plan by 2030

4:40:37 PM | 1/13/2011

Vietnam’s Prime Minister Nguyen Tan Dung has approved functions of a master development plan for Central Highlands region from now by 2030, the government said.
 
Under the plan, the Central Highlands will focus on exploring and processing bauxite, producing rubber and coffee among products for export and also developing hydro-power plants.
 
By 2030, the region, including Kon Tum, Gia Lai, Dak Lak, Dak Nong and Lam Dong is expected to cover an urban site of 32,500 hectares from the current 16,300 ha and accommodate 7.32 million persons from 5.11 million persons at present.
 
The Vietnamese leader assigned ministries and branches to carry out the planning within 18 months. (chinhphu.vn)
